Achievement Gap, Northampton Arts Night Out, Women @ Work: Springfield Museums

Urban League of Springfield President Henry Thomas discusses the achievement gap between African American students and white & Asian students in Mass. Arts Night Out Northampton is a monthly community arts iniative that brings people together to create and celebrate art in downtown Northampton. Preview Springfield Museums' exhibit on artist Isabel Bishop, part of the Springfield Women@Work project
